Exploring the Purpose and Use of Dialog Boxes

In⁤ the realm ‍of ⁢computer interfaces, dialog boxes play a crucial role in facilitating communication between ⁢users and the system. ⁤These pop-up windows serve as ​a means for the system to convey ​important information, prompt ⁤for user⁣ input,‍ and initiate various actions. From simple⁤ confirmation messages to complex configuration settings, dialog boxes ⁤are omnipresent in software applications. In this⁢ article, we ‍will explore the various aspects of dialog‍ boxes, ⁣their functionality, and their ⁣impact‌ on user ​interaction in the ⁢digital ⁤world.

Table‌ of Contents

What⁢ is a Dialog Box?

A dialog⁤ box is ​a small​ graphical window⁢ that is⁤ used to prompt the‍ user to make a decision or enter information. It typically⁣ appears on​ top of ⁤the current ​page or⁢ application‍ and requires the user⁤ to interact with it before continuing. Dialog boxes are commonly ‌used‌ in software applications to display alerts, warnings, or‌ messages, ‍and to gather input from the ⁢user.

Dialog ⁣boxes can contain various elements such as text,⁤ buttons,‍ input fields, and⁢ checkboxes. They‌ are designed ‌to be‍ simple and easy to understand, providing clear instructions to ‍the user ⁤on what‌ action to take. Dialog boxes can be modal, meaning​ that they must be dealt with before the user can continue interacting with the main application,⁢ or⁤ non-modal,⁢ allowing the user ⁤to interact with the main application ⁤while the dialog box is open.

Using ⁤dialog boxes can enhance ⁤user experience by guiding users through tasks and helping ⁤them⁣ make informed decisions. When designing a ​dialog ‌box, it’s important to consider the user’s⁤ expectations and ⁢make ‌the dialogue clear and concise. Proper use of ⁣dialog boxes can streamline user interactions and ⁣improve the overall‌ usability of an application.

Key Elements⁢ and ​Functions⁤ of a Dialog Box

A dialog box is a crucial element of ⁢user interface‌ design that is used to display information, ⁢prompt ⁣decisions, or gather input from the ‌user. ​It typically ‌appears as a⁤ pop-up window on top of the⁢ current page or application, ‍effectively ‍pausing the user’s interaction with the rest of ‌the interface ​until​ the ‌dialog ‌is closed. There ‍are several‌ that contribute to⁢ its effectiveness and usability:

Elements ‌of‌ a​ Dialog Box:

Title Bar: The title bar typically contains the name or brief description of the dialog⁢ box to provide context to ‌the‍ user.
Content Area: This is where the ‍main message or information that the dialog box is ⁣intended to convey ‍is ‍displayed.
Buttons: Dialog boxes ⁢often include buttons such ⁤as “OK,” “Cancel,” or‌ “Yes” and “No” to⁣ allow⁤ the user to respond to the prompt or take ​action.
Functions of a ​Dialog Box:

Input ⁣Gathering: Dialog boxes⁢ can be used to collect⁣ input from the user, such as entering text, selecting options, or⁤ making choices.
Information Display: ⁢They ​are often ‍used to display ‍important information, alerts, warnings, ⁢or confirmation ‌messages to the user.
Decision ‍Making: Dialog boxes prompt ⁢the⁢ user‍ to ⁤make decisions or confirm actions before ‍proceeding, enhancing ‌the control⁢ and clarity of the user interface.
In summary, understanding the is essential ⁢for⁤ designing ⁣intuitive and user-friendly interfaces. By‍ carefully considering the content, layout, ⁣and functionality of dialog⁤ boxes, designers can create a more ⁢seamless and engaging ​user experience.

Best‍ Practices for Designing ⁤a User-Friendly Dialog ‍Box

When designing a ‌user-friendly​ dialog⁤ box, there‌ are⁢ several best ⁢practices ‍to keep in‍ mind to ‌ensure a seamless and ⁢intuitive user experience. One‌ of ⁢the primary considerations is ⁣the placement of the dialog box. It should⁣ be strategically positioned on⁢ the screen to grab the user’s attention without being intrusive. Additionally,⁢ the size of the dialog⁢ box ​should be appropriate ‌for ⁤the content it contains, preventing unnecessary scrolling or ⁢overwhelming the user with ⁣excessive information.

Another⁣ crucial aspect of designing ​a user-friendly dialog box is the use of clear and concise ​language. The text within the ‌dialog ​should​ be easy to ⁢understand and provide‍ clear instructions or information to the user.‌ It’s also⁢ essential⁢ to‍ use consistent and familiar language ⁢to ensure that the‍ user ‌knows what to‌ expect when interacting with the dialog⁤ box.‍ Additionally, consider the use of visual elements ⁤such‌ as icons ⁣or graphics‌ to‌ enhance the clarity of the information presented.

Furthermore, providing clear and actionable buttons within the dialog box ‍is⁢ essential​ for guiding ⁤the ​user through the interaction. Use descriptive labels on the buttons ‌to convey the outcome of⁢ the action, ‍such as “Confirm” ⁢or “Cancel”, ‌and ensure that‍ they are ‌easily ⁤clickable. Additionally, consider incorporating‌ keyboard shortcuts for power users who⁣ may prefer to⁤ navigate the dialog box without using the ⁣mouse. By‍ following ⁢these best ⁤practices, you can design a user-friendly dialog box that ⁤enhances the overall user experience on your website or application.

1. Strategically position the dialog box on⁣ the screen.
2. Use clear and concise language within​ the dialog.
3. Incorporate clear and⁢ actionable‍ buttons with ​descriptive labels.

Common Mistakes to ‍Avoid When Implementing Dialog Boxes

Dialog boxes are a ⁢crucial element of user interface design, but they can ⁣be tricky to implement effectively. ⁣When designing and implementing ‍dialog boxes, it’s important ‌to steer clear ‌of ‌common mistakes ⁣that⁤ can hinder the user experience and overall ⁢functionality of your ​application ​or website. Here‍ are ‌some key⁢ mistakes⁤ to avoid:

Overloading with⁤ information:⁣ One common mistake ‌when implementing dialog boxes is trying to cram too much information‌ into them. ⁢This can overwhelm ⁣users and make it difficult for them to make decisions. ⁣Keep dialog boxes ​concise and focused ⁣on the key information or ⁢action required.

Unclear or ambiguous messaging: Another mistake to avoid is using ⁣unclear⁣ or ambiguous messaging within dialog​ boxes. Clarity is essential in ensuring ‌users ⁢understand the‍ purpose of the dialog box and what action‍ is‍ expected of ​them.⁤ Use ‍clear ​and concise language‍ to communicate the message⁢ effectively.

Poor placement and design:⁣ Dialog ⁢boxes that are poorly ‍placed​ or⁢ designed‌ can‌ disrupt the user flow⁢ and create frustration. Ensure that dialog boxes are positioned where ​they naturally⁤ fit within the ⁣user interface, and that their design ‍is ‍consistent with the overall aesthetic of the application or website. Additionally, consider using visual cues such as icons or⁤ bold​ typography to draw‌ attention to⁤ the dialog​ box ⁤and its‍ purpose.

By being mindful ‌of these ‌common⁣ mistakes and implementing dialog‍ boxes with ‌care, you can enhance the user experience and optimize the functionality​ of your interface.

Q&A

Q: What is a dialog box?
A:​ A dialog box is a small window that appears on a computer screen⁣ to prompt the user to take an​ action or to provide information.

Q: ‍What are some ‌common⁤ uses for dialog⁢ boxes?
A: Dialog⁤ boxes ⁤are commonly ‍used to display ​error messages, request user ⁤input, ⁤confirm actions, or provide ⁣information to the⁢ user.

Q: How‌ are ‌dialog boxes different ​from regular windows?
A:⁣ Dialog boxes are typically modal, ​meaning that they require the ‍user to interact​ with them before they ⁢can ‌continue⁤ using the main application or⁢ interface. They are also ‍usually⁢ smaller and more focused⁢ than regular windows.

Q: What are some examples of dialog boxes in everyday computer use?
A: ⁢Examples of​ dialog boxes ⁤include the “Save As” dialog ​in‍ file management applications, alert messages in web browsers, and⁤ confirmation prompts when deleting files​ or ​closing applications.

Q: How should ‍developers design effective ⁣dialog ⁣boxes?
A: Developers should ensure that dialog ⁢boxes⁢ are ​clear, concise, and ⁣provide the user with actionable ⁣information. They should also consider ⁤the context in which ‌the dialog box will appear and ⁣make sure​ it ⁣is visually consistent with the overall interface.

Q: Are there ‌any best ⁢practices for using dialog boxes in user interfaces?
A:​ Yes, it is​ important to use dialog⁣ boxes sparingly​ and only when‌ necessary, to ‍avoid ‍overwhelming the​ user with ⁢too ⁤many interruptions. Additionally, providing clear‍ explanations ⁤and options for the ⁤user in the⁣ dialog ⁤box⁣ can‌ improve the ‌overall user experience.

Insights ‌and Conclusions

In conclusion, ⁤dialog boxes play ​a⁢ crucial role in the user interface ⁣of various software applications, providing users with important information, warnings,‍ and opportunities for input. Understanding how⁣ to ‍effectively utilize and design dialog boxes is ⁢essential​ for creating​ a user-friendly and intuitive experience. By following best practices and considering the needs of the​ end user, developers can ⁤ensure that dialog boxes enhance functionality and facilitate ⁤clear communication. As‍ technology continues​ to evolve,⁢ the role of‍ dialog boxes in software design will ⁢undoubtedly ⁢remain significant,⁤ making it imperative⁤ for designers and developers to stay informed about best practices and emerging trends in this area.⁤ Thank ‍you for reading and we hope⁤ this‌ article‌ has⁣ provided valuable insights into the world of dialog boxes.

Latest articles

Related articles